How much does a good paint job cost for a truck?

Consumers spent between $1000 and $3500 for what they described as good-quality, “thorough” paint jobs. According to consumers who reported their prices to the site, it takes at least $2500 to obtain a “showroom quality” paint job.

How much is a color change paint job on a truck?

Most new similar-color paint jobs cost between $5,000 and $7,000, however, some may charge more. Painting a color change typically takes between $7,000 and $10,000 to complete. As your budget will dictate, you may spend over $10,000 on the Matte, Pearl, or Chameleon paint application.

How much does it cost to paint a whole truck a different color?

For more thorough and high-quality paint jobs, you can expect to pay between $1,000 and $3,500, on average. For a custom paint job or something that’s more showroom-quality, you could pay up to $20,000 or more. Of course, larger semi-trucks or service body trucks will cost more to paint than cars and pickup trucks.

Is it cheaper to wrap or paint a car?

Is It Cheaper to Get a Car Wrapped or Painted? An inexpensive paint job is usually cheaper than a car wrap. A higher-quality paint job with multiple coats will cost about the same as a car wrap.

How long does it take to paint a truck?

A complete vehicle paint job will take between 40 and 80 hours, depending on the size of your vehicle and the bodywork that is needed.

How much does it cost to paint a f150?

You can expect to spend in the range of $2500 to $4000+ to fully repaint a Ford F-150 truck. If You decide to keep it the same color it was then it might be a bit cheaper and if You want to go with a completely different color then the price will reach the high end of that range.

How long does a car wrap last?

In general, a car wrap can last for up to seven years depending on the type of vinyl used. If you are thinking about using a vinyl wrap car design to promote your business, remember that high-quality wraps last longer than thinner films and serve as a better return on your investment.

How long do wraps last for?

Under normal conditions, the average lifespan of a vehicle wrap is about five years. Another factor that can impact wrap lifespan is the installation process. A wrap that’s not properly installed can quickly start showing signs of wear, conditions like peeling or getting dirty under the wrap.

Does car wrap last longer than paint?

Vehicles wraps are generally more durable than paint. While a top-tier paint job can last the life of a vehicle, standard paint jobs typically only last a couple of years. A high-quality vehicle wrap will last up to 10 years.

Is matte paint more expensive?

Paint Care

All in all, matte paint is more expensive to maintain. This is why the finish is only found on high-end vehicles. Also, the paint is more vulnerable to the abrasive materials in a drive-through car wash.

Is it hard to paint a car black?

Prep and color-sanding is what really makes a black car. The more difficult cars to paint black are the ones with large, flat body panels. A lot of body guys will shy away from painting big vehicles black because it is so hard to get huge panels perfect.

How much does it cost to undercoat a truck?

If this service is applied at the dealership, it may cost up to $1,000, depending on the make and model of your vehicle. Some dealers include it in a package of services that are priced even higher. When you do the job yourself, then the cost can be less than $100 for cars and under $150 for trucks and SUVs.
